Here’s what that moment reminded me of.
We all assume that what we know is basic. That if we know it, surely everyone does.
But that’s not how it works.
This person had spent years in marketing and had never come across one simple thing.
Your clients are exactly the same.
The questions you think are too obvious to answer are the ones your audience is Googling at midnight.
The things you explain in your sleep because you’ve said them a hundred times are the things your potential clients have never heard explained clearly.
So when it comes to creating content, here’s what I want you to do.
- Say “you” not “everyone.” Speak directly to one person, not a crowd. It changes how your content feels immediately.
- Answer the simplest questions you get asked. Not the complex ones. The ones that feel almost embarrassing because they’re so basic. Those are exactly the ones people need.
- Never think something is too simple to share. The marketing expert in that room would disagree with you.
